// SANDBOX_TIMEOUT_MS governs how long a user-supplied formula may
// run inside the Quillbox evaluator before it is terminated. Support:
// if a customer reports "formula timed out" errors, do NOT raise this
// value without sign-off from the Lattice team, since long-running
// formulas can starve the shared worker pool. When escalating, include
// the tenant name and the evaluator build token, which is pinned just
// below this constant.

session token of bajog-tadup = htk3_ffc

Handover — Dray to incoming contractor.

Websocket reconnect bug in Pinlock client: reconnect storms when the Ostra broker restarts. Suspect missing jitter in backoff. Repro steps in the runbook; staging creds in the sealed vault. Fix branch is half-done, tests red. Vault opens with the passphrase below.

vault phrase of yawig-bawig = fenael-norael-eliox-gilox-casath-druath-zorys-istwyn-jorwyn

Subject: Quickstore 4.2 — bloom filter now fronts the KV layer

Plugin authors: starting with this release, Quickstore places a bloom filter ahead of the key-value store. Negative lookups return faster; false positives fall through safely. No API changes are required on your side. Verify your plugin against the staging build referenced below.

session token of fahif-tadup = htk3_9c7

Runbook: the Tillgate kiosk watchdog. Quick version for reviewers: a tiny daemon pings the kiosk UI every 20 seconds and hard-restarts it after three misses. It runs unprivileged, writes only to its own log directory, and can't touch the payment sandbox. If the watchdog itself dies, the device reboots within two minutes via a hardware timer. Each signed watchdog release carries a verification token, recorded immediately below.

pipeline stamp: htk31_f769b577b3028a4e9958e5bb8d1259a